1.19.73 is a hotfix to Bedrock Edition released on March 29, 2023, which fixes bugs.[1]

While this wasn't the last update to 1.19.0, it was the last one before the beta/Preview builds of 1.20.0 started.

Fixes

  • Fixed several crashes that could occur during gameplay.
  • Fixed a crash that could occur with Command Blocks using teleport commands.
  • Fixed a bug where the player's aim height was not adjusting correctly when sneaking. (MCPE-167559)
  • The first player in a splitscreen game will no longer have their input interrupted by other players opening up a container or inventory screen. (MCPE-168610)
  • Fixed an issue where Ghast volume and volume distance were too low. (MCPE-168324)
  • Fixed duplicate tooltips appearing when selecting item in the inventory while using touch controls. (MCPE-166866)
